Two FFXIV Games on one computer? Follow

#1 May 13 2014 at 4:08 AM Rating: Default
I have been sharing my computer with my son who plays at different times than I do. However, he now wants to have his own game where he can create more chars etc.

So he has purchased another edition of the game.
My game is via Steam.

How can we have both games installed on one computer. I realize we have to open a new account for my son which won't be a problem. But installing the game on the same computer may cause problems? It may be ok especially since the first version is via Steam.
I don't know enough about computers to work this out so we have hesitated doing anything with the second copy we have.

Advice would be greatly appreciated.

Maybe if my first version was not via Steam I could just keep the one game and simply log in with the different account number. But having one acc on Steam probably is different.
Also the version my son got is a Collectors edition he managed to buy off somebody at work (who had it but changed his mind playing it since he is now hooked on Dark Soul) so that may have more stuff on it than the Steam regular version I purchased.

Do you still log in with the launcher when you use the steam version? When it launches you should be able to just change the account logging into the game. I can't see you being able to install the game twice.

Also, the collectors edition items are tied to the account, not to the disc or anything so no problem there, as long as the person you bought it from hasn't used the code already. If he did you got ripped off.

The Steam version of the game will be just fine. When it comes to any MMO, the important part is the account subscription ( username a password). The only thing you need to do is to register his game key and create a account for him, it does not matter if is a normal or ce version since the different is only games items which he will received in game by SE.

After his account is register, he can log on using your computer just normal, I would recommend using the Token Key from the beginning since it will eliminated having to deal with the security location e-mail when you log in from a new location every time. You can have 20 people even more playing each with their own account on the same computer if you wanted, just one person at a time can use the computer. The game it self does not matter, is only the account (log in username and password).

Sharing the same PC you're better off sharing an account. Unless you plan on getting a second PC or a console to play together. Doesn't make sense to pay two sub's if you have to take turns to play. Everyone else answered your question though :)

If you haven't already registered the game to another account, you can use it to upgrade your own. You'll both get the CE items and you can pay a much smaller fee. Would make more sense to get extra character slots rather than another monthly subscription unless you're both alt-o-holics.
